ALEXANDRIA, Va., Sept. 17 -- United States Patent no. 12,417,393, issued on Sept. 16.
"Generative content registration system and method of use" was invented by Shaunt M Sarkissian (Reno, Nev.) and David Campbell (Morgan Hill, Calif.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A generative content registration system may include a processor. A generative content registration system may include a non-transitory memory coupled to the processor configured to store a generative content registration database comprising generative content registration data.
